Abstract
Manganese(III) mediated oxidative free radical reactions between indole derivatives and 1,3-dicarbonyl compounds are described. In the presence of dimethyl malonate, the oxidative free radical reaction of 3-unsubstituted indoles resulted in the formation of 2-(3-oxo-2-indolylidene)malonates and these malonates can be prepared in much better yields from corresponding 3-indolecarboxylic acids. On the contrary, the oxidative free radical reaction between 3-unsubstituted indoles and 2,4-pentanedione or ethyl acetoacetate gave furo[3,2-b]indoles.{A figure is presented}.
